1. Tyler Christian Summers was born on December 31,1995 and is an American professional football linebacker for the New York Giants of the National Football League.
Ty Summers played college football for the TCU Horned Frogs, and was selected by the Green Bay Packers in the seventh round of the 2019 NFL draft.
Ty Summers played in 51 games for the Horned Frogs starting 32.
Ty Summers recorded 317 tackles with 23.5 for a loss and 10 sacks during his college career including a career high 121 during his sophomore campaign.
Ty Summers received second-team all-Big 12 Conference honors in 2016 and honorable mention all-Big 12 honors in 2017 and 2018.
Ty Summers was selected by the Green Bay Packers in the seventh round of the 2019 NFL draft.
Ty Summers entered the 2021 season as a core special teamer and backup linebacker.
Ty Summers was waived by the Packers on August 28,2022.
Ty Summers was claimed off waivers by the Jacksonville Jaguars on August 31,2022.
Ty Summers was waived three days later and re-signed to the practice squad.
Ty Summers was waived on August 29,2023 and re-signed to the practice squad, but released the next day.
On May 16,2024, Ty Summers signed with the Jacksonville Jaguars.
